The Sea of Cortez, often called 'the World's Aquarium,' is one of nature's most vibrant marine playgrounds, located along the coast of La Paz, Baja California Sur. This stretch of turquoise water is famous for its incredible biodiversity, drawing snorkelers and divers from around the globe. La Paz Divers offers an up-close encounter with the gentle giant of the sea—the whale shark. On this guided tour, you'll don snorkeling gear and glide into the warm, clear waters where these massive yet docile creatures swirl lazily, feeding on plankton. The experience is surreal—seeing the whale sharks’ distinctive pattern of white spots as they move gracefully through the water is enough to take your breath away. But this adventure isn't limited to whale sharks; playful sea lions, pods of dolphins, and occasionally, orcas make this trip a wildlife enthusiast’s dream.
